Magnaflow is stainless so will last. Get the quad tip or some replacement tips for it. It's quiet-ish but you will appreciate that if you add headers and/or remove cats. I've heard the Hooker on stock and full exhaust cars, not my taste, but it's just that. The Magnaflow has a cleaner sound to my ear. It IS better quality, though, seeing is believing on that one.

Loud exhaust gets old on a daily driver, remember that.
